Indiana University Health is seeking individuals who embody these values to join our Talent Acquisition leadership team in the role of Executive Director – Workforce Development.

The Executive Director - Workforce Development develops and oversees the system-wide Workforce Development strategy and its supporting initiatives, aimed at creating a robust workforce pipeline to support the evolving needs of Indiana University Health. This role involves close collaboration with system and regional teams to ensure alignment between workforce management initiatives and business objectives. The Executive Director will partner with the senior HR team to create and oversee the implementation of proven best practices for workforce development with local and national partners.

Responsibilities include providing governance and oversight of several workforce development initiatives, including the growth and optimization of the Mosaic Center for Work and Life. The Executive Director will also understand talent forecasts to build and implement effective workforce development strategies that advance IU Health’s recruitment and hiring practices, as well as the requirements, policies, and service level agreements necessary within healthcare organizations and partnerships.

Utilizing research and data analysis, the Executive Director will develop and sustain a comprehensive program that includes design, research, key performance indicator determinants, reporting, training, team member oversight, and collaboration with program partners to ensure effective resource utilization and support. This role requires engagement with senior executive-level leaders as a credible, results-driven, and valued partner by initiating proactive discussions and decisions around mission attainment, business performance, financial operations, negotiations, and the development of key talent programs and processes to identify and address current and future business and staffing challenges.

The Executive Director will establish, maintain, and grow working relationships with program funders, partners, employees, institutions, and other not-for-profit organizations to meet client and neighborhood needs and ensure program success. Collaboration with community partners and local businesses across the state is essential; candidates must demonstrate cultural competence and humility to cultivate strong relationships with neighborhood residents. The Executive Director will implement a comprehensive program that addresses diverse needs (cultural, ethnic, mental, physical, socio-economic, etc.) of internal and external participants and their families, ultimately contributing to the health and prosperity of the community. Additionally, this role is critical in driving talent acquisition initiatives aligned with organizational goals while fostering a culture of continuous learning and professional growth.

Reports to: Senior Vice President - Chief Human Resources Officer

  • Bachelor’s degree is required; Master’s degree is preferred.
  • A minimum of 10 years of relevant experience.
  • Degree in Human Resources, Business Administration, Organizational Development, or a related field.
  • Minimum of 7 years in workforce development, talent management, or a related field in a matrix organization, with at least 4 years of experience leading a team.
  • Strong strategic thinking with the ability to align partnership opportunities with organizational priorities.
  • Demonstrated entrepreneurial and innovative leadership, with proven experience working with diverse and/or underserved communities.
  • Strong understanding of talent acquisition principles and practices, emphasizing diversity, equity, and inclusion.
  • Demonstrated ability to innovate, design, and implement workforce development programs and initiatives.
  • Knowledge of relevant regulations and standards governing workforce development and training programs.
  • Proficiency in data analysis, report writing, and the ability to interpret complex information to inform strategic decisions.
